Subject: Partner SFTP drop — new owner

Hi,

As you review the pending changes to the Harborline ingest scripts, note that ownership of the partner SFTP drop is changing at the end of the month. This includes key rotation, the nightly pull job, and the quarantine folder for malformed files. Review comments on the retry logic should still go through the normal PR flow, but questions about drop-folder conventions or partner onboarding now go to the new owner. The incoming owner is listed below.

signatory, tagaf-bahaf: Praael Fenmir Rusok

Quarterly Planning Note — Concentration Risk

Heads of department: quick flag that Orvatek now accounts for roughly 38% of revenue, up again this quarter. That's too many eggs in one basket, so pipeline targets will tilt toward mid-market wins in the Lorvale region. Nothing dramatic yet, just keep it in mind when staffing. Our thinking on next steps is set out below.

management briefing: The pricing group signed off on a budget of $378.8 million for Project Kasael.

- [ ] **Step 7: Breaker override escrow.** After sealing the signing keys for the Tallgrove upstream API circuit breaker, confirm the support team can force the breaker open during a full outage. The override bundle lives in the sealed escrow drawer and is useless without its unlock phrase. Two ceremony witnesses must initial this step before proceeding. The escrow bundle is decrypted with the recovery passphrase that follows.

vault phrase of kahip-kahop = holath-quenmir

Heads up for plugin authors: undo/redo in Sketchloom is snapshot-based, not command-based, so every plugin action you register gets a full diagram delta stored in the history ring. On big canvases that adds up fast — we've seen plugins blow past the memory ceiling by pushing a snapshot per mouse-move instead of per gesture. Batch your mutations, and the ring stays comfortably small even on Torvane's monster org charts. The ring sizing and eviction knobs you're working against are these.

tuning table, faweg-bajep:
WEIGHTS = {
    "belius": 690,
    "eliox": 458,
    "norax": 616,
    "praion": 132,
    "zorvan": 911,
}